Antique 1820s English SILVER LUSTRE Lid Jar/Trinket Box: Poor Man's Silver#2 Up for sale is a rare antique English silver lustre lid jar or trinket box or perhaps a serving piece for the dinner table. When the middle class began to emerge in the early to mid 19th century they wanted silver serving sets like the upper class. But couldn't afford it. That's when these economical earthenware silver lustre pieces were crafted-their shiny silver was popular with the middle class. Antique Coffee Pot with Matching Lidded Biscuit Jar. The base mark dates this to the 1800s. As from 1842 to 1883, the British Patent Office issued registration numbers inside of a diamond so that the public could be assured of quality and a true British design. Unfortunately, the mark is now mostly unreadable, and we cannot ascertain the date of registration. The top mark is definitely the Roman Numeral IV, and therefore that assured the customer that this material is Clay Ware. The Coffee Pot Measures approximately 8-1/2" tall including its lid.
